Weekend Race Recap
Knoxville, TN (March 23-24, 2001)
Friday

Knoxville, TN got a lot of awesome Monster Truck action on Friday night. The drivers had a tough drive because the track was slick and sticky, but it obviously didn't stop anyone! Rap Attack, Taurus, Rambo, Devestator, & Bad News were all out tonight, and ready to run. Rambo took the Monster Truck Racing Competition first prize. Highlighting the Freestyle competition was Rap Attack, who won with an awesome wheelie, however, no one will forget Taurus. He rolled over right at the beginning of the show!!
There was an intense competition for Super Trucks causing a big grudge between men & women. Kathy Bowles won the main, and the women went nuts!! The crowd was also thrilled with Galactron & Reptar. They loved every minute of it!
Saturday

They couldn't be at the Monster Truck World Finals II in Las Vegas, and they couldn't even be at home watching it on Pay-Per-View! Why? Because they were too busy watching the action-packed show in Knoxville!!
In the tradition of last nights show, the same trucks took the same prizes with a whole new set of tricks. The track was much better for the drivers tonight. Rambo won the Monster Truck Racing Competition. The incredible run by Rap Attack highlighted the night, he did a reverse wheelie & car jump during the Freestyle Competition that was just killer!!

Once again, it was guys against girls in the Super Trucks, but Kathy Bowles didn't wanna give up her title. She won both the grudge and the main event. The crowd just couldn't get enough! And Galactron & Reptar thrilled the crowd, as if they could have been thrilled any more than they already were!!
